0 reports about 1825636261The number was first reported 3rd Aug, 2025
Received a phone call from 1825636261? Report here
File a report about 1825636261 |
Phone Number Variations: 1825636261, 01825-636261, 911825636261, 001825636261, 1911825636261, +1911825636261